It feels like just a couple weeks ago that we were discussing U.S. Open outrights doesn’t it? Well, that’s because we were. Due to the changes in the 2020 schedule, tennis’ French Open begins Sunday, just two weeks to the day after the U.S. Open Men’s Final.

Much like the U.S. Open, there are some mass withdrawals from the Grand Slam, notably defending women’s champion Ash Barty and current U.S. Open women’s champion Naomi Osaka. Also absent for the ladies includes Bianca Andreescu and Belinda Bencic, which means four of the top-10 women will be missing from the tournament.
